Fritz Bosch is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and Radiation. According to data from OpenAlex, Fritz Bosch has authored 30 papers receiving a total of 466 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 17 papers in Nuclear and High Energy Physics and 6 papers in Radiation. Recurrent topics in Fritz Bosch’s work include Atomic and Molecular Physics (20 papers), Nuclear physics research studies (15 papers) and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(5 papers). Fritz Bosch is often cited by papers focused on Atomic and Molecular Physics (20 papers), Nuclear physics research studies (15 papers) and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(5 papers). Fritz Bosch coll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Poland. Fritz Bosch's co-authors include Yu. A. Litvinov, Richard Marrus, K. Traxel, P. Charles and N. Winckler and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Physical Review Letters and Analytical Chemistry.
